Bleeding gums is usually due to gingivitis which is associated with many factors;
-Microorganisms, plaque and calculus deposition.
-Food impaction,
mouth breathing.
-Faulty tooth brushing habit.
-Nutritional deficiencies.
-Endocrine changes like puberty, menstural cycle, pregnancy,
diabetes mellitus.

In the meanwhile;
-Brush your teeth regularly with a soft bristle toothbrush.
-Replace your toothbrush every six months.
-Brush in back and forth, up and down motion and rinse your mouth after every
meal.
-Use
chlorhexidine mouthwash regularly.
-Take complete balanced diet with plenty of raw vegetables, vitamin C
containing food in your diet like lemon, oranges etc.
-Take multivitamin suplements.
-Drink plenty of water and keep yourself hydrated.
-Also check your menstural cycle, blood sugar level.
